Character and Assessment of Learning for Religious Vocation
In 2006, the Association completed this four-year program that addressed the
ability of theological schools to understand the character
of learning that religious vocation requires and the schools'ability to develop
the resources and skills needed to assess the attainment
of such learning. Program elements included five research
studies and school-based efforts that developed patterns, models,
and resources for use by other ATS member institutions. The project, funded by Lilly Endowment, generated helpful assessment resources.
